A parking garage charges $3.00 plus $1.50 for each hour. You have

$12.00 to spend for parking. Write and solve an equation to find the
number of hours that you can park.

Answer:

(12-3)/1.5= 6

Explanation:

You subtract $3 from $12 for the first fee and then divide $9 by $1.50 to find how many hours you can stay.
